JPM Stock Hovers Just Below Its 52-Week High of $359.25 as Bulls Eye a Breakout

JP Morgan Chase & Co. is trading at $357.37 on Wednesday, July 29, 2026, just $1.88 below its 52-week high of $359.25 set during yesterday's session, with price holding virtually flat on the day. The stock has staged a significant run from its 52-week low of $279.10, representing a gain of more than 28% over the past year. With price consolidating at the upper edge of its annual range, traders are watching closely to see whether JPM can clear and hold above the $359.25 ceiling or fade from this extended level.

Key Drivers of the JPM Stock Move

The forward setup for JPM is defined almost entirely by what happens at the $359.25 level. A confirmed daily close above that mark would constitute a 52-week high breakout, a signal that systematic and momentum-oriented strategies often use as a buy trigger. On the other hand, if price continues to stall and volume dries up, the $354.15 yesterday low becomes the first meaningful support level to watch on any near-term pullback. The flat price action today, combined with the proximity to a major resistance level, suggests the market is in a wait-and-see posture heading into the next catalyst.
